Transaction 64bc925edff53c62470edcbe7010227969d96ef13efa222dbc80268a5378646e
1 Input
2 Outputs
- 64bc925edff53c62470edcbe7010227969d96ef13efa222dbc80268a5378646e:0
- 64bc925edff53c62470edcbe7010227969d96ef13efa222dbc80268a5378646e:1
value 41595
address 1oTTjNJEc2kke66nTN8gZgJwwgDzQcqsr
value 114047
address 1KFHt9y4eEmaSSPujAKhZcLS3M33Apw9LA